In What Manner Do Peptides Promote Collagen Development?

The generation of structural protein is fundamental for upholding skin structure and firmness, and molecular compounds contribute significantly to fostering this cycle. These linked sequences of constituent elements serve as signaling molecules, engaging with cellular structures to enhance collagen synthesis. When applied topically or ingested, these molecules can traverse the outer layer, activating fibroblasts—biological units generating this protein—to maximize their output.

Studies show that specific peptide compounds, such as palmitoyl pentapeptide, can enhance the skin's elasticity and diminish the appearance of fine lines by stimulating collagen formation. Additionally, peptides can help to regulate the degradation of collagen, maintaining a balanced turnover. This dual action of stimulating new collagen production while safeguarding existing collagen contributes to a more youthful-looking and resilient skin appearance. Ultimately, adding peptides into skincare routines can significantly enhance skin health and vitality by increasing collagen levels.

The Way Amino acid chains Aid in Healing Your Skin

By harnessing their special properties, peptides play an essential role in skin repair and regeneration. These short chains of amino acids act as messenger elements, stimulating cellular processes needed for skin repair. When applied topically, peptides help boost the production of collagen and elastin, key proteins that maintain skin structure and elasticity. Such stimulation can result in better skin texture and reduced appearance of fine lines and wrinkles.

In addition, peptides offer anti-inflammatory properties, which can relieve sensitive skin and speed up the repair of wounds and blemishes. Their capacity to strengthen the epidermal barrier is also notable, as it helps preserve moisture and protect against environmental stressors. By encouraging cell regeneration, peptides promote the emergence of new, healthy skin cells, resulting in a fresher and more vibrant look. All in all, the addition of peptides into skincare routines can markedly enhance skin health and resilience.

Discover How Peptides Can Support Improved Health

Disclosing many health benefits, peptide compounds are earning acknowledgment for their potential to optimize overall well-being. These short chains of protein building blocks play an critical part in numerous biological processes, leading to enhanced health outcomes. For example, some peptides support muscle growth and recuperation, making them valuable for active individuals and sports enthusiasts. Additionally, they can support immune response, allowing the body fend off illnesses more effectively.

Peptides contribute to metabolic regulation, which can facilitate weight management and general vitality. Various peptides are noted to enhance cognitive function, possibly improving concentration and recall. Additionally, their anti-inflammatory effects may ease chronic conditions, delivering relief and enhancing well-being. As research continues to reveal the diverse functions of peptides, their value for advancing health and vitality becomes more apparent, making them a promising addition to a holistic approach to wellness.

Implementation Techniques For Effectiveness

Getting the most out of peptides in your skincare routine requires proper application techniques. To start, it's crucial to wash your face completely to eliminate dirt and debris that might block penetration. After washing, using a toner can help prepare the skin, enhancing peptide efficacy. Peptides should be placed on moist skin, as this increases penetration. A few drops of peptide solution should be softly worked into your complexion, focusing on areas of concern. Following the serum, a moisturizer seals in the peptides, ensuring they remain effective. Consistency is key; using peptides daily can produce optimal outcomes.
